The purpose of this study is to evaluate the feasibility and performance of the Percutaneous Ultrasound Jejunostomy (PUJ) procedure that utilizes a novel device (PUMA-J System) in conjunction with widely available ultrasound technology and endoscopic guidance. The procedure will be performed in up to 10 eligible subjects. Patients will be followed for 2 days following performance of PUJ to assess for potential complications.
Jejunostomy tubes (J-tubes) provide a path for nutrition delivery directly into the small intestinal lumen, bypassing the mouth, esophagus, and stomach for patients who have difficulty with proximal gut feeding. Many medical conditions may require J-tubes, including cancers, gastroparesis, and patients with high risk of aspiration. A recent innovation by CoapTech addresses technical and procedural limitations of current jejunostomy tube placement methods by leveraging ultrasound for visualization and magnets for control of the jejunal loop. The Percutaneous Ultrasound Magnet Aligned (PUMA) System enables clinicians to affix jejunal loops superficially via magnetic coaptation and visualize the planned stomal tract using ultrasound. The purpose of this pilot clinical study is to test the feasibility of the PUMA-Jejunostomy (PUMA-J) System in adults requiring a jejunostomy tube. This is a single-center, non-randomized, non-blinded feasibility study to evaluate the performance and safety of the PUJ procedure that utilizes a novel device (PUMA-J System).

Procedural Success
Rate of procedural success in completing jejunostomy tube placement using the PUMA-J System
Time frame: Procedure timeframe
Procedural Aborts
Description of occurrences of procedure abort
Time frame: Procedure timeframe
Device Related Serious Adverse Events
Rate of Device Related Adverse Events following Jejunostomy procedure
Time frame: 48 hours of procedure performance
Adverse Events
Rate of all Adverse Events following Jejunostomy procedure
Time frame: 48 hours of procedure performance
Rate of inadvertent puncture of vital organs
Description of occurrences of inadvertent puncture of vital organs during performance of procedure
Time frame: Procedure timeframe
Requirement for salvage surgery due to complication of the procedure
Description of occurrences of salvage surgery performed due to complication of procedure
Time frame: 48 hours of procedure performance
